Radioactive iodine and cesium in Bavarian citizens after the nuclear reactor accident in Chernobyl

Description

In order to evaluate the radiation risk and to improve the procedure of prognostic estimations of a follow-up study of whole body radioactivity in human beings living in Munich or in an area within 100 km distance from it was initiated after the accident. A total of about 200 persons were examined. After the accident some of them changed their normal diet to avoid excessive intake of radioactivity, some continued their normal way of nutrition. Within 4 weeks following the accident special attention was paid to the measurement of 131I. One week after the accident the mean total body content of 131I was about 300 Bq. Subsequently it decreased with a halftime of 9.2 days. The total body content of 137Cs and 134Cs began to increase significantly 4 weeks after the accident. 14 weeks after the accident a plateau was reached at a level of 14 Bq 137Cs and 7 Bq 134Cs per kg body weight. This plateau was kept until 30 weeks after the accident. A second increase of the Cs radioactivity was observed in January 1987 due to the increasing radioactivity in milk and meat. This is a result of the use of contaminated hay harvested within the period right after the accident as winter feed for cattle. The dose equivalent commitment based on the authors measurements of 137Cs and 134Cs in 1986 ranged from 0.04 to 0.1 mSv
